Boreas - An International Journal of Quaternary Research
Boreas, an International Journal of Quaternary Research, has been published on behalf of Collegium Boreas since 1972. The journal features articles of wide global interest from all branches of quaternary research, including biological and non-biological aspects of the quaternary environment in both...
